Convection Heat

A wall-mounted fireplace is a fantastic alternative for homeowners who do not have enough space to install a full-size fire place. They are available in a range of designs and sizes which means you can find one that fits your needs perfectly. You'll also find options that feature heat, which can help keep your room nice and cozy all year round.

A wall-mounted fireplace can go virtually everywhere in your home, without the need to cut an opening in the wall or vent pipes. This makes them a very suitable option for those who rent their homes or don't have the time for a full-scale renovation project. The mounting hardware is included and it is possible to mount the fireplace on the wall.

A fireplace that is wall-mounted can be surface mounted, or recessed into the wall. A fireplace mounted on the surface is designed to be mounted directly on the wall. A recessed model is designed to fit into a smaller space in your home's wall.

The majority of wall mounted electric fireplaces produce some form of heat which could take the form of a fan-forced heat source or an infrared heater. Some models may even be equipped to offer both flame effects and heat. These models also have a display panel that allows you to select the desired temperature and control the flame effects.

You can use a remote control to operate most of these models, and a few will even have built-in Bluetooth functionality so you can connect them to your mobile device for added convenience. Certain models might also come with a timer that will shut the fireplace off after a pre-determined period of time.

Ventless Design

In contrast to traditional gas fireplaces that require chimneys and flues to vent the combustion process, some wall-mounted fireplaces are built with ventless technology. These models are powered by propane, natural gas electric or gel canisters and don't emit fumes or harmful exhaust.

These vent-free units are ideal for contemporary interiors, where a clean frameless design is preferred. They offer customizable options like a variety of color fire media as well as decorative coals or Carrara pebbles, which can be added to the burner to cover the flames. Certain models come with the option of a mantel built-in and include an electric remote for simple operation.

In addition to aesthetic considerations Some homeowners also appreciate the security benefits of vent-free gas fireplaces. Ventless gas appliances are rated by the manufacturers for use in specific areas of the house at levels of oxygen at sea level. This helps prevent oxygen depletion that can lead to dangerous air quality or carbon monoxide.

Ventless gas fireplaces also do not require chimneys or a flue. This means that they are less costly to install and also have a smaller footprint. They're easy to use, and there are no burning or cleaning issues to worry about. However, homeowners should be aware that these units may produce odors that can be unpleasant. It is also recommended to avoid placing combustible materials adjacent to or near the fireplace.

Certain models include an oxygen sensor that aids to ensure the burners work properly. The sensors can help reduce the danger of dangerous fumes building up inside the vent. However they shouldn't be used to replace regular inspections and maintenance. It is recommended that homeowners install additional carbon monoxide alarms around their home.

Energy-Efficient

Consider the power requirements when selecting a wall-mounted fireplace. The more expensive options might require a hardwired connection for installation and the best output of heat. They're also generally larger than freestanding models. Make sure you read the specifications of the manufacturer's dimensions and weight. This will ensure that the unit can be fixed to the wall without any additional support or anchoring. It is best to consult an expert to find the best model for your space.

Another benefit of a wall mount fireplace is its energy efficiency. A wall fires-mounted electric fire uses less energy than a wood-burning or gas fireplace would require to produce the same amount of heat. It's also more affordable to run than traditional fireplaces since it doesn't require a chimney, a hearth or an ongoing fuel supply.

Some models even come with built-in thermostats, which automatically adjusts the heating in accordance with your preferred settings. This feature is great for those who don't remember to lower the thermostat or leave the house often during the daytime. You can also control your wall-mounted electric fireplace with a handy remote or an app.
